Maintaining your vehicle is crucial for ensuring its longevity and performance. Understanding the basics of car repair can save you time and money, and help you address issues before they become major problems. This guide provides essential tips and insights into car repair, from routine maintenance to handling common issues.

Routine maintenance is the cornerstone of car repair. Regularly changing the oil, checking fluid levels, and inspecting tire pressure can prevent many issues from arising. Make sure to follow the manufacturer’s recommended maintenance schedule for your vehicle. Regular maintenance not only extends the life of your car but also improves its safety and performance.
Recognizing common car problems early can prevent costly repairs down the road. Some of the most frequent issues include engine overheating, transmission problems, and brake wear. Pay attention to warning signs such as unusual noises, vibrations, or warning lights on your dashboard. Addressing these issues promptly can prevent further damage and ensure your vehicle operates smoothly.

While some car repairs can be done at home with basic tools and knowledge, others require professional expertise. Simple tasks like changing oil or replacing air filters can be handled by DIY enthusiasts. However, complex repairs, such as engine overhauls or transmission work, should be left to certified mechanics. Assess your skills and the nature of the repair to decide whether to tackle it yourself or seek professional assistance.

Selecting a reliable mechanic is vital for quality car repair. Look for a repair shop with good reviews, certifications, and a solid reputation in your community. Don’t hesitate to ask for recommendations from friends or family. A trustworthy mechanic will provide transparent estimates, explain repairs in detail, and offer honest advice on your vehicle’s condition.
